Components of the Windshield Washer System
The windshield washer system consists of several key components, including the washer fluid reservoir, pump, hoses, and nozzles. The washer fluid reservoir is the container that holds the washer fluid, which is typically a mixture of water and a cleaning agent. The pump is responsible for pressurizing the system and spraying the fluid onto the windshield. The hoses connect the reservoir to the pump and the nozzles, which are responsible for directing the fluid onto the windshield.
In addition to these components, the windshield washer system also includes a series of electrical connections and switches that control the system’s operation. The system is typically activated by a switch on the steering column or dashboard, which sends an electrical signal to the pump to start spraying fluid.
Common Causes of Windshield Washer System Failure
There are several common causes of windshield washer system failure, including:
- Clogged nozzles or hoses: Debris, dirt, or mineral deposits can clog the nozzles or hoses, preventing the fluid from flowing properly.
- Low washer fluid level: If the washer fluid reservoir is empty or low, the system will not function properly.
- Failed pump: The pump can fail due to wear and tear, electrical issues, or blockages in the system.
- Electrical issues: Problems with the electrical connections or switches can prevent the system from functioning.
- Freezing temperatures: In cold weather, the washer fluid can freeze, causing the system to malfunction.
Understanding these common causes of failure can help diagnose the issue and identify the necessary repairs.
Troubleshooting the Windshield Washer System
Troubleshooting the windshield washer system involves a series of steps to identify the source of the problem. The first step is to check the washer fluid level and top it off if necessary. Next, inspect the nozzles and hoses for any blockages or damage. If the nozzles are clogged, try cleaning them with a small brush or replacing them if necessary.
If the issue persists, check the pump and electrical connections for any signs of damage or wear. If the pump is faulty, it may need to be replaced. In some cases, the entire windshield washer system may need to be replaced if the problem is widespread.

How much does it cost to replace a faulty windshield washer pump or other components?
The cost to replace a faulty windshield washer pump or other components can vary depending on the make and model of your car, as well as the specific part that needs to be replaced. On average, a replacement pump can cost between $50 to $200, while a new nozzle or hose can cost between $10 to $50. Labor costs can add an additional $50 to $100, depending on the complexity of the repair and the mechanic’s rates. It’s essential to consult your car’s manual or a professional mechanic to determine the exact cost and to ensure the repair is done correctly.
